What is Building Water Sampling Services LLC?

Building Water Sampling Services LLC are specialized companies that provide water sampling and testing for buildings to ensure water quality and safety. These services typically involve collecting water samples from various points within a building's plumbing system, such as taps, cooling towers, and water storage tanks. The samples are then analyzed for contaminants like lead, bacteria (such as Legionella), and other harmful substances. This helps property owners and managers comply with health regulations and maintain safe water conditions for occupants.

What are some common challenges faced by technicians in building water sampling services, and how can they be addressed?

Technicians in building water sampling services often encounter challenges such as gaining access to secure or restricted areas, ensuring sample integrity during collection and transport, and adhering to strict regulatory guidelines. Addressing these challenges typically involves clear communication with building management, thorough training on sampling protocols, and meticulous documentation. Technicians also benefit from staying up-to-date with local and federal water quality standards, which helps ensure compliance and reliable results.

About RED-Rochester

RED-Rochester LLC, is the primary utility provider and district energy supplier for the 1,200-acre Eastman Business Park, one of the world’s most comprehensive industrial campuses located in Rochester, NY. RED-Rochester owns and operates a highly reliable and efficient utility infrastructure that delivers a full suite of services—utilizing high pressure industrial boilers and a gas turbine-supporting electricity, steam, chilled water, and other critical utilities across the park. These services are distributed through a dedicated microgrid and industrial systems designed to meet the demands of diverse industrial and commercial tenants.

Position Summary  

This role is responsible for the operations and maintenance on RED’s industrial water, boilers, compressed air, and steam distribution systems within Eastman Business Park. This would include, but is not limited to starting and stopping equipment, making adjustments as needed to online units both manually and via the distributive controls system (DCS), and unloading chemicals used in water treatment and testing. This role is required to follow and enforce company procedures to maintain a safe workplace and comply with regulatory requirements. 

Essential Responsibilities

  • Perform routine boiler room, refrigeration and water treatment systems equipment inspections and performance including documentation of operational data, checking and adjusting of controls on equipment as necessary.
  • Oversee the proper operation of the water treatment plant, boilers, turbines, and distribution systems with the shift operations teams, ensuring all teams adhere to the proper procedures & guidelines
  • Assist with repairs as needed on all equipment and distribution systems piping. 
  • Conduct sampling and testing of chemical treatment systems including the unloading of bulk chemicals. 
  • Provide operating support for equipment shutdowns and startups including securing of equipment using standard LO/TO procedures. 
  • Assist with maintaining equipment in a clean and operable condition. 
  • Assist with the development and updates of standard operating procedures. 
  • Maintenance duties as needed including refrigerant handling, leak repair, pump packing adjustments, etc.
  • Provide operating support for overhead distribution piping systems. 
  • Other duties as assigned such administrative, proper record keeping, inspections, etc. 
  • Must adhere to all safety protocols and regulations.
